Translate to English Relativ heller, leicht rauchiger, dazu etwas vegetabiler bis kräuteriger und mandeliger Kern- und Steinobstduft mit einer Spur Muschelschalen. Schlanke, zart süßliche Frucht mit an Haselnuss und Heilkräuter erinnernden Nuancen, moderate Säure, leichter Gerbstoff-Griff, kreidige Noten, ordentlicher bis guter Abgang.
